Output 06b5308050711f7542126e6f9e203463599daa0eca787b9bfa284bfd2e1be176:1

value
20539727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 428309a954a18e8e07c03b0b5602c036cf586b3d OP_EQUAL
address
37khVsCfm7cGShBusfuwf3SvnkVJAwqvpE
transaction
06b5308050711f7542126e6f9e203463599daa0eca787b9bfa284bfd2e1be176
spent
true